Ingredients of Plum E-Luminence Deep Moisturizing Creme:  

Aqua (Water/solvent), Glycerin (skin-identical ingredientmoisturizer/ humectant,) Helianthus Annuus (Sunflower) Seed Oil (emollient), Caprylic/Capric Triglyceride (emollient), Betaine (moisturizer/ humectant), Propanediol (solventmoisturizer/ humectant), Glyceryl Stearate Citrate (emollientemulsifying), Glyceryl Stearate (emollientemulsifying), Garcinia Indica (Kokum) Seed Butter, Cetearyl Alcohol (emollientviscosity controllingemulsifyingsurfactant/ cleansing), Simmondsia Chinensis (Jojoba) Seed Oil (emollient), Vitis Vinifera (Grape) Seed Oil (antioxidantemollient), Tocopheryl Acetate (antioxidant), Niacinamide (cell-communicating ingredientskin brighteninganti-acnemoisturizer/ humectant), Benzyl Alcohol (preservativeviscosity controlling),  Dehydroacetic acid  (preservative), Potassium Sorbate (preservative), Fragrance (perfuming), Calendula Officinalis (Calendula) Flower Extract (soothingantioxidantperfuming), Matricaria Recutita (Chamomile) Flower Extract (soothingantioxidant), Sambucus Nigra (Elder) Flower Extract (soothing), Salix Alba (White Willow) Bark Extract (soothing), Trifolium Pretense (Red Clover) Flower Extract, Rosa (Rose) Flower Extract, Xanthan Gum (viscosity controlling), Hippophae Rhamnoides (Sea Buckthorn) Fruit Oil (antioxidantemollient).

Packaging – Plum E-Luminence Cream For Dry Skin

Product Packaging:

The Plum E-Luminence moisturiser comes in a 50 ml translucent glass jar, securely packaged in a small cardboard box. The jar includes an additional inner lid to prevent leakage, and all product details are provided on the outer box. I packed it carefully in my makeup bag (along with other beauty essentials) for the journey back from India to the UK and had no issues with leakage! It’s absolutely travel-friendly if packed properly.

Product Performance: 

Plum e-luminence moisturizing cream has a rich, creamy formula that absorbs quickly into the skin upon application. It has a mild, sweet herbal scent that isn’t overpowering, though those sensitive to fragrances might find it less suitable.

The weather in the UK is currently cold and dry, making this cream perfect for my combination skin, which becomes quite dry during winter. It keeps my skin nourished all day, lasting until my PM routine! My skin feels softer, plumper and happier after each use 🙂.

I’ve also tried this heavy-duty Vitamin E crème in summer as a nighttime moisturiser. I love that it hydrates the skin without leaving a greasy residue, making it an ideal choice even for those with oily or sweaty skin. It feels lightweight and non-heavy on the skin, which is a big plus!

an image of plum e-luminence deep moisturizing creme vitamin e moisturiser on top of it's outer cardbox packaging
Plum Vitamin E-Luminence Moisturizing Cream

This Vitamin E moisturiser claims 24-hour hydration; however, since I don’t typically wear it for such extended hours, I can’t comment on this claim 😕.

I usually apply my moisturisers after a face mist and serum on freshly cleansed skin. However, Plum’s Vitamin E Crème alone is sufficient to keep my skin hydrated in colder weather. When I complete all my skincare steps (Cleanse + Tone + Serum + Moisturize), my skin looks especially soft and radiant 😍.

The cream includes several skin-loving, soothing ingredients, such as Kokum Butter, Sea Buckthorn Oil, Vitamin E, Niacinamide, Glycerin, Calendula Flower Extract, Chamomile Flower Extract, Elder Flower Extract, and White Willow Bark Extract. Note that it contains seed oils; if you have oil sensitivities, I’d recommend a patch test before use.

Since this Plum E-Luminence face cream lacks SPF, you can use it both day and night. It also works well as a base moisturiser under foundation or concealer ❤️.
